ICACC
ICACC represents an ongoing partnership between the local Aboriginal Community and eight Local Government authorities in the southern area of Melbourne.
Our Vision
To achieve and enhance respect, recognition, reconciliation, equity health and wellbeing for Aboriginal people
Our Focus
- to enhance and promote Aboriginal culture, society and heritage that exists throughout the lands and waters of the ICACC region in all aspects of the landscape that are important to Aboriginal people as part of their heritage.
- to link Aboriginal communities to the broader community
- to identify needs and gaps in services and areas where cooperation can be improved between Aboriginal communities and all levels of Government, and to make recommendations and develop strategies by which these needs can be addressed.
- to work with Aboriginal stakeholders, tiers of Government and other agencies within the region to understand the need to involve Aboriginal perspectives in decisions they make.
- to contribute and encourage strategic planning and policy development for the advancement of social/cultural, economic and environmental development
The eight Councils that make up this area are:
- Bass Coast Shire
- Cardinia Shire
- City of Casey
- City of Kingston
- Knox City Council
- City of Greater Dandenong
- Frankston City Council
- Mornington Peninsula Shire
Background Information
The Inter Council Aboriginal Consultative Committee was formed in 1997 out of an initiative by the Municipal Association of Victoria (MAV), and was established by a group of eight Local Government Councils, Aboriginal organisations, service providers and Aboriginal community members who have come together to address issues affecting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ander communities within this region.
ICACC represents an ongoing partnership between the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ander community and eight Local Government Authorities of Mornington Peninsula Shire, Bass Coast Shire Council, Frankston City Council, City of Casey, Knox City Council, Kingston City Council, City of Greater Dandenong and Cardinia Shire.
The ICACC secretariat was formed in 2005. Equally funded by the eight Councils, the Secretariat is staffed by a part-time employee who provides administrative support to the ICACC Committee and its members. The Secretariat is hosted by Councils on a two-year rotating basis. It is currently hosted by the City of Frankston.
Local Government Liaison Group (LGLG)
The LGLG Committee consists of eight elected Aboriginal Representatives from the ICACC region, eight delegated Councillors and eight appointed officers from the member Councils.
The LGLG develops partnerships between Aboriginal people, agencies and governments. Essentially it is the working group for ICACC. It ensures Community Forums are organised, addresses needs, establishes priorities, seeks funding for ICACC projects, reports back to the Community on issues and developments, disseminates information, and advocates on needs identified by the community.
The LGLG meet quarterly, hosted by ICACC Councils on a rotating basis.
